      Research Methods in Applied Linguistics is the first and only journal devoted exclusively to research methods in applied linguistics, a discipline that explores real-world language-related issues and phenomena. Core areas of applied linguistics include bilingualism and multilingualism, computer-assisted language learning, conversation analysis, corpus linguistics, critical studies, discourse analysis, forensic linguistics, identity, language assessment, language policy and planning, language and migration, literacy, pragmatics, psycholinguistics, raciolinguistics, second language acquisition, sociolinguistics, teacher education, and translation and interpreting. The journal takes a domain-specific approach and publishes articles investigating current and new methodologies that have been developed for and/or are incorporated into the discipline of applied linguistics and its subdomains. The journal does not exclude submissions investigating methods and tools that are also applicable to, or introduced from, other disciplines, but they must be examined from the perspective of applied linguistics and for the purpose of solving problems in this discipline. The scope of the journal encompasses all aspects of research methods, including research design, data collection, data coding, data analysis, and reporting practices. The journal welcomes research from all paradigms, be they quantitative, qualitative, or mixed, and methods of all kinds, whether they are utilized to observe the occurrence of a phenomenon or behavior, explore correlations, or examine causal relationships.

      Neuroscience and BioBehavioral Reviews is a peer-reviewed journal publishing reviews that integrate brain function and behavior across a range of areas including physiology, psychology, health and disease across the entire lifecourse of model organisms, and humans. The journal publishes review articles, mini-reviews, opinion pieces, and society consensus statements, which are novel and of exceptional significance.Submiss... to the journal are actively encouraged which deal with topics not only in the more traditional areas of behavioral neuroscience, and psychology, but also in the following areas, whenever the reviews bring new insights into brain-behavior relations or biobehavioral health: Aging biology and geroscience, Biological psychiatry, Cognitive neuroscience, Computational modelling and AI, Developmental biology, Endocrinology, Evolutionary Biology, Genetics, Immunology, Metabolic regulation and nutrition, Neuroeconomics, Neuropsychology, Physiology, Pharmacology, and other related disciplines. We do not publish empirical papers, and no unpublished data should be included in the manuscripts. New analyses and modelling of previously published and publicly available dataset are allowed as long as their inclusion is essential to support the narrative of the Review. Simple data re-analyses (including meta-analyses) without a new conceptual or theoretical framework will not be considered. We welcome review articles from clinical researchers whose submission exceeds the high-quality threshold for the journal and significantly advances our understanding of a field.We require a statement disclosing any use of AI tools to assist in writing the acknowledgements section. If none, simply state “No AI tool was used to generate any part of the paper”.
